Why Critical Thinking and Mathematical Logic Matter
Before diving into the specifics of the course, it’s crucial to understand why these skills are so vital. Critical thinking involves the ability to analyze information, evaluate arguments, and make reasoned decisions. Mathematical logic, on the other hand, provides a rigorous framework for problem-solving and reasoning. Together, they form a powerful combination that can enhance your problem-solving capabilities and decision-making processes.
